#12431b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#12431b is composed of 7.1% red, 26.3% green and 10.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 59.7% yellow and 73.7% black. It has a hue angle of 131 degrees, a saturation of 57.6% and a lightness of 16.7%. #12431b color hex could be obtained by blending #248636 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

● #12431b color description : Very dark lime green.
#12431b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#12431b has RGB values of R:18, G:67, B:27 and CMYK values of C:0.73, M:0, Y:0.6, K:0.74. Its decimal value is 1196827.

Shades and Tints of #12431b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010502 is the darkest color, while #f5fcf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#12431b
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#292c29 is the less saturated color, while #025311 is the most saturated one.
